Are Your Kids Ready For Bunk Single Beds?

Bunk single beds are a great option to reduce space. They also can help build a bond between siblings. However, it is important to make sure that your children are prepared for bunk beds prior to deciding to purchase bunk beds.

It can be difficult to change the sheets on bunk beds. If this is the case you might want to consider two single beds instead.

They're an excellent way to save space

Bunk beds are a great way to save space in a small area. They are also great for children who share the same room, or for teens who host sleepovers with friends. There are numerous bunk bed designs available for both kids and adults. Some have additional storage space under the lower bed. They're a great way to transform an empty corner into a sleeping area and they look fantastic too.

The most important thing to think about when choosing a bunk bed is its material. Some bunks are constructed from solid wood, while others are made from manufactured materials like particleboard and veneers. Solid wood bunks are more durable but also more expensive. No matter the material you choose the bunk should be sturdy enough to support two children and their toys.

You can also find bunks that have integrated features such as desks, shelves, cubbies and much more. These features not only help conserve space, but also give your children an opportunity to organize their rooms. They are particularly useful for children with a lot of books or toys.

Another option is to purchase an upholstered wall bunk bed that is a great option for smaller rooms or rooms that serve double duty, such as a home office that converts into a guest room when guests visit. These bunks are compact and can be folded against the wall when not being used. They are also simple to put together and come in a variety of colors to fit into any decor scheme.

It's important to take into account the color and style in the space where you intend to put the bunk bed. For instance, a bunk bed that has a lot of details or distressing might not work well with a contemporary decor scheme. It's a good idea for your children to pick a bunk bed that isn't too high, Single bed size bunk beds as they may be unable to climb up and down. Also, make sure you buy a mattress that's appropriate for your bunk.

They're an excellent way to have two kids in one room

Bunk beds are a great solution for families with children who don't have much space. They are fun, safe, and space-efficient for siblings who share the bedroom. You can also save money on furniture. However bunk beds aren't suitable for everyone, so it's crucial to consider all the advantages and disadvantages before making the decision.

The standard bunk beds are constructed of metal or wood and comprise of a bed that is stacked on top of the other. Typically, the top bed is accessible by a ladder, which is great for children who enjoy sharing a room. You can also get a bunk that has stairs that are wider and kinder to the feet, so they're safer to climb.

A bunk bed with drawers, or a chest with a built-in is another option to accommodate two children in the same room. This will allow each child to have a place to put their belongings and clothing and makes the room more organized. Some bunk beds come with slides that can provide a fun element to the room.

There are also some bunks that include desks beneath and is a great option for teenagers or preteens who want to stay together, but require a bit more privacy. It's also a great idea for the child who has outgrown their twin-sized bed and needs to transition to a larger.

The twin-over-full bunk bed is a popular option. It features an upper bed that is twin and a full-sized bed on the bottom. This is a great choice for families that have more of an age gap and less of a size gap in that your older child can sleep on top, while the younger one can sleep in the bottom. The majority of bunks are designed to accommodate twin, twin-XL and even full-sized beds. So you can change the configuration as your child grows. Bunk beds can easily be converted into two separate bed for overnight guests. If you're concerned about space, you can always choose bunk beds that have trundle designs, which allows for the third mattress to be folded out under the bed below.

They're a great way to encourage children to sleep with each with each other.

Rooms for children can be tight on space, especially when there are two kids in the same room. bunk bed with single bed beds are a great solution to make space and let children sleep in a group. Your kids will enjoy them since they're stylish and fun. If you're looking to buy an ordinary bunk frame or a themed one there are a variety of options to choose from.

Kids love bunk beds as they let them have more fun in their room, making it easier for them to fall asleep. They also offer a safe space to play since they are not easily accessible from the ground and are generally secured by rails or ladders. Bunk beds are an excellent option for children with active imaginations, as they can be transformed into castles, pirate ships or secret hideouts.

If your kids love to host sleepovers, a bunk bed is the perfect solution. They'll be thrilled to invite their friends to sleep with them in a relaxing and comfortable manner. You can even add a pull-out or futon bed at the bottom of the bunk, so that your children's guests have more options for sleeping.

The process of getting your kids to share a bedroom can be a struggle but it could be beneficial over the long term. It teaches them life lessons about sharing and being courteous to others, and it will make them feel more connected to their siblings. It can be a great way to establish routines that can be shared for bedtimes as well as other activities.

Bunk beds come in different styles and materials, such as wood and metal. Some have storage spaces and study areas. Others are more versatile and practical. Some are more playful with features like slides and tents. There are bunk beds that convert into twin single beds which makes them a great option for older children or adults who live together in a room.

It is crucial to consider the dimensions of the room for your child as well as the amount of space you need. Measure the room before deciding on a model, and check that the mattress fits properly. You should also choose a bed that matches the style of the of the space to create a functional arrangement.
